Mays, Buddy
Buddy Mays (b. 1943) is an author, travel writer and photographer. The bulk of his work concerns the American Southwest, Southwestern history, wildlife, outdoor recreation, whitewater rafting, and southwestern Indians.
From the description of Papers, 1961-1984 (bulk 1970-1984). (University of Wyoming, American Heritage Center). WorldCat record id: 27891344
